When exports exceed roughly 200k rows, the Ledgerloom worker buffers the full sheet in memory, which has caused OOM kills on the Bartleby pool. Mitigation: set `EXPORT_STREAMING=true` and `EXPORT_CHUNK_ROWS=5000` in `.env.worker`, which switches to streamed writes with bounded buffers. Verify `WORKER_MEMORY_LIMIT_MB=2048` matches the container limit, since a mismatch silently disables backpressure. Streamed exports are written to the encrypted staging bucket, and the worker needs the bucket credential, which is set on the following line.

env line for fafof-fahag: LEDGER_TOKEN5=f8790

Quick update on Ferrowist, our PDF invoice renderer. POST /render accepts an invoice payload and returns a signed PDF within two seconds at p95. Template changes now hot-reload, so no redeploy needed. Rate limit is 40 renders per minute per tenant; exceeding it returns 429 with a retry hint. Batch mode ships next sprint. For sync demos, hit the staging renderer authenticated with the internal key below.

API key for yahig-tadup: kto7_ubizbYm

Ticket CAL-219: Plannerly's two-way sync with Driftmail calendars is duplicating events when both sides edit within the same minute. For the security review: conflict resolution currently trusts whichever payload arrives last, with no signature check on the sync delta, which feels sketchy. We'd like your eyes on the merge path before we ship the fix. The candidate build is identified by the token directly below.

pipeline stamp: htk9_ce63042d9

Handover Note — Director Transition, Orvell & Strade

From: D. Marchetti. To: L. Feysen. Key item: retirement of the Coppermill product line. Timeline set, final builds end next quarter. Spares commitment runs 24 months. Branch managers have migration scripts for affected customers — push them to the Ashgrove range. Two distributors still hold Coppermill stock; buyback terms agreed. Watch the warranty backlog. Everything else is in the shared tracker. One strategic point remains confidential and is noted below.

board note of bawep-tajef: Queniusek Systems plans to raise the Quenvan list price by 53.1 percent in March. The pricing group signed off on a budget of $176.4 million for Project Drueth. The renewal with Casionix Partners closes at $142.5 million a year, 8.3 percent below the last contract. Project Fraax slips by six weeks because of the tooling delay.